"What he's done over the past five years has never, ever been done — and probably will never, ever happen again," Sampras said in a telephone interview with The Associated Press. "Regardless if he won there or not, he goes down as the greatest ever. This just confirms it."

Roger has been in the last 20 STRAIGHT Slam semifinals. That's DOUBLE what the next nearest player accomplished. I am going to go out on a limb and say that will never be broken.
And aside from Nadal, has won every Slam final that he's been in for the last 5 years. That's another record that will never be broken.
He SHOULD get 15 or more slams. And he should do it in far less time than Sampras did (5 years for Federer vs. 10 years for Sampras). Nobody will repeat that.
